Experiencing the Truth
Copyright © Grant Lawrence (2004)

Words are a part of the Truth, but they are not the whole Truth. Instead, we need to know that the Truth is the here and now, all around, and not separate from anything. It is not found completely in this or that person, or this or that structure, but rather the Truth is Life -- our unity of being.

To know Life we have to experience it, to know the Truth we have to experience it, to know our shared existence we have to experience it. At all times, we are in Life, Truth, and the One (they are not separate and there is no separation), but we have to unblock our awareness to understand it and to have the joy of it. In order to "unblock our awareness", things likely have to be shaken up for us once in awhile. Suffering shakes us deeply but we can use the suffering that we experience as a way to greater being or higher consciousness. But, in order to come to this greater understanding we must let suffering show us that All beings know it. When we identify with the suffering of others then we come to identify with our shared existence. We can let suffering "shake us up" into the realization of Oneness, the realization of Truth, but we have to stop blocking our awareness of it.
